    I have Intel Turbo Memory in my m15x with T9300 processor, VUltimate, 2GB ram and Seagate 200GB 7200RPM 16Mega Cache. In Turbo Memory console there is enabled Windows ReadyBoost but permamently disabled Windows ReadyDrive and I cannot enable this readydrive. I've tried to reinstall all system, ITM drivers, and still nothing. RaadyDrive is disabled. How about Your Alienware and ITM ??? Please help

    We have to try a few things first else there are reports of people having to re install Vista to get the TurboDrive working properly

    1. we have to enable AHCI and Robson in the BIOS.
    2. make sure you have 'Intel(R) 82801HEM/HBM SATA AHCI Controller' in your Device Manager under 'IDE ATA/ATAPI controllers'. If not, reinstall the Turbo Memory software. You should have both the Intel Matrix Software and the Turbo Memory software listed in all programs.
    3. Enable ReadyBoost and ReadyDrive in the 'Turbo Memory Console'. This might take a few boots for it to activate.

    ok then, update, just downloaded the driver for the turbo memory off the intel site. it installed and rebooted, 1st reboot it bluescreened, then 2nd attempt it worked. now got turbo memory and the matrix folders in all programs, and both readyboost and readydrive are enabled. so, maybe you all should download the drivers from the intel site. it says new drivers but i dont know what if any i had installed before.
